Output 3142ea5f57eee1f81ec474203ffda131c101be3268a409965c1d3dd15cd4466e:7

value
8123500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16ae16c99f42dd2097cc6f53d20ac70460d9a439 OP_EQUAL
address
33kwLgSNTYBAGHaLg7i7eHfSvp3v7KcJ4q
transaction
3142ea5f57eee1f81ec474203ffda131c101be3268a409965c1d3dd15cd4466e
spent
true